9th Annual Inclusion Summit Seeks to Improve + Celebrates Successes Surrounding Equity in Action

The Greater Des Moines Partnership’s 9th Inclusion Summit took place on Nov. 10, 2021 at the Des Moines Area Community College Ankeny Campus with an option to join in virtually. The event, which focused on the theme of “Equity in Action,” included a packed agenda, with speakers covering diversity, equity and inclusion (DEI) topics designed to make an impact with Greater Des Moines (DSM) business leaders and help them build equity-centered systems within their organizations.

2021 Inclusion Award Winners

At the Inclusion Summit, four Inclusion Award winners were also announced to honor organizations who have gone above and beyond to champion DEI efforts. This year’s winners included two large businesses, those with more than 500 employees (Hy-Vee, Inc., Wells Fargo), one medium-sized business with 151-500 employees (NCMIC) and one small-sized business with 1-150 employees (United Way of Central Iowa). Greater Des Moines Partnership

The Greater Des Moines Partnership is the largest regional business, economic development and talent development organization in Iowa and the second-largest regional chamber of commerce in the country, serving 12 counties in Greater Des Moines: Adair, Clarke, Dallas, Guthrie, Jasper, Madison, Mahaska, Marion, Marshall, Polk, Poweshiek and Warren. Together with more than 400 Investors and an Affiliate Chamber of Commerce network of more than 7,200 Regional Business Members, The Partnership helps businesses grow and advances quality of life in Greater Des Moines with one voice, one mission and as one region, contributing to a vibrant regional economy.
